On an August day in Memphis, Tennessee, the life of 21-year-old Anthony DeWayne Pope was tragically cut short. The young African American man was fatally shot on August 29, 2016, outside a convenience store on Hawkins Mill Road in the Raleigh neighborhood. The incident, captured on the store's surveillance video, showed a man approaching Pope with a handgun as he was exiting the market and shooting him in the chest.
